Before I came down here I wanted my first week in America to fly by and that's exactly how it went. Now that I'm here in Brasil I've realized no matter what kind of preparation I had done, I still wouldn't have been prepared for this kind of transition. There's a certain kind of acceptance here in Brasil that as an American I've never understood. During my first day right after I got picked up from the airport we were driving around Ilha do Governador (Governors Island) in Rio picking up furniture to move and the truck we were using broke down about five times. Nobody yelled at us or gave us a hard time, we would just hop out push the truck out of the way and it was all good. I remember thinking to myself "Man I could get used to this" people here in Brasil have a special way of dealing with situations and it's really cool to see how everybody works together. So here I am dealing with all sorts of things I'm not used to and I couldn't be happier.
